package com.englishtown.vertx.metrics;
import com.codahale.metrics.Gauge;
import com.codahale.metrics.MetricRegistry;
import io.netty.util.concurrent.EventExecutor;
import io.netty.util.concurrent.SingleThreadEventExecutor;
import org.vertx.java.core.Vertx;
import org.vertx.java.core.impl.VertxInternal;
import org.vertx.java.platform.Container;
import static com.codahale.metrics.MetricRegistry.name;
/**
* Provides gauges for vertx event loops
*/
public class VertxEventLoopGauges {
public VertxEventLoopGauges(Vertx vertx, Container container, MetricRegistry registry) {
register(vertx, container, registry);
}
protected void register(Vertx vertx, Container container, MetricRegistry registry) {
if (vertx instanceof VertxInternal) {
VertxInternal vertxInternal = (VertxInternal) vertx;
int count = 0;
for (EventExecutor ee : vertxInternal.getEventLoopGroup()) {
if (ee instanceof SingleThreadEventExecutor) {
final SingleThreadEventExecutor executor = (SingleThreadEventExecutor) ee;
try {
registry.register(
name(Utils.DEFAULT_METRIC_PREFIX, this.getClass().getSimpleName(), "executor-" + count++, "pendingTasks"),
new Gauge<Integer>() {
@Override
public Integer getValue() {
return executor.pendingTasks();
}
});
} catch (IllegalArgumentException e) {
// Assume this is due to multiple instances
}
}
}
} else {
container.logger().warn("Vertx is not an instance of VertxInternal, cannot access event loops.");
}
}
}
